Singled out for the ‘technical quality‘ of its team and its ‘integrity in client representation‘, Ferro, Castro Neves, Daltro & Gomide Advogados has a pre-eminent reputation in arbitration, and regularly acts in some of the most high-stakes proceedings in the market. With a notable track record in representing blue-chip companies in international matters, including cases before the International Court of Arbitration (ICC), the practice excels in shareholder disputes and cases involving the construction and infrastructure sectors. Marcelo Roberto Ferro, who has a strong reputation in this sphere, has worked as counsel in a variety of cases under the rules of the ICC and UNCITRAL arising from civil, commercial, corporate and construction conflicts. He heads the group alongside Rio de Janeiro-based partner José Roberto de Castro Neves, who is devoted to litigation and arbitration. Karina Goldberg is often engaged in domestic and international cases involving contractual, commercial and corporate law, while Eduardo Pecoraro is especially active in construction and corporate disputes. Other key individuals include Natalia Mizrahi Lamas, who is based in the Rio office; Antonio Pedro de Souza, a contact for energy and oil and gas clients; and Julia Grabowsky Basto Fleichman. All named practitioners are based in São Paulo unless stated otherwise.
